On August 1st, our Spokane community suffered a nearly incomprehensible disaster as fires tore through our city — including the neighborhood we love and call home, where our church building is also located.

 

To date, 6 families have suffered a complete loss of their home, property, and possessions, and nearly half of our roughly 400-member congregation has been displaced, living in temporary housing due to necessary evacuations — with friends, relatives, in hotels, or other accommodations.

 

Many people and churches have asked how they can specifically help, and we have set up a Fire Relief Fund for our church.

 

These resources will be used to care for the immediate, mid-term, and long-term needs of ITC members, and as the Lord gives opportunity, for the good and upbuilding of others in our area.

 

Although there is much tragedy, we grieve with great hope because of the goodness and faithfulness of the Lord.

The Gospel and Foregiveness

November 25, 2018 Speaker: Matt Jolley Series: The Gospel And...

Passage: Matthew 18:21–35

HOME GROUP DISCUSSION

- Read the parable of Jesus that begins in verse 23 of Matthew 18. Whose part in it represents our lives? What does that say about our debt to God and our need for forgiveness? What way has God created so that we can be forgiven?

- Why is forgiveness important in the live of a follower of Christ? What does it say to the world? What does it do for the church?

- Have you ever struggled to forgive someone? Why was it hard? Have you ever thought you had forgiven someone and then discovered you really hadn't? How can we help each other with that?

- Ultimately, why do we forgive?
